Trump Halts Military Aid to Ukraine After Oval Office Clash With Zelensky

President Donald Trump has ordered a pause on military aid to Ukraine following a heated Oval Office exchange with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ky on Friday, a White House official told CNN on Monday.

“The President has been clear that he is focused on peace. We need our partners to be committed to that goal as well. We are pausing and reviewing our aid to ensure that it is contributing to a solution,” the official said.

According to another official, the suspension applies to all military equipment not yet delivered to Ukraine. The decision, they added, is a direct response to what Trump perceives as Zelensky’s “bad behavior” during their meeting.

The pause could be lifted if Zelensky demonstrates a renewed commitment to negotiations aimed at ending the war. In the meantime, White House officials are seeking an acknowledgment from Zelensky regarding the recent breakdown in relations.
